Glorious Grace!
TNIV Scripture for Wednesday, August 27, 2008 [Ephesians 1:3-6]
Praise be to the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, who has blessed us in the heavenly realms with every spiritual blessing in Christ. For he chose us in him before the creation of the world to be holy and blameless in his sight. In love he predestined us for adoption to sonship through Jesus Christ, in accordance with his pleasure and will--to the praise of his glorious grace, which he has freely given us in the One he loves.
Paul wrote Ephesians to tell about God's awesome grace and how it can reflect in your life as you continue to walk in it through the grace exchange. As you put off your weaknesses and put on God's grace (wisdom, strength, courage, ability etc.), as an ordinary person, you can live an extraordinary life.
God's grace
Blessed you in heavenly realms with every spiritual blessing in Christ
Chose you before the creation of the world to be holy and blameless
Loves you
Predestined you for adoption to sonship through Jesus Christ
Freely gave you His glorious grace
